The disguised Coupe and Cabrio have now hit the streets. So it is only a matter of time before they are caught by the photographers around the FIZ.
Something else is in development both from Garching and the FIZ which if caught would mean a headline expose in the auto media. Coupe and therefore Cabrio will not appear in 2012. More like 2013. The public development programme takes about two years after entry programme within BMW's private test grounds. Which currently you can see the next X5 and X6.

Excerpt from recent Interview with BMWNA M Manager Matt Russell:
Are there any other special edition M3s coming before end of production for the E92/E93 M3 coupe and convertible? You shouldn’t be surprised if we have some more. The car is not at the end of the production. We have the car until 2013 [calendar year] as a coupe and convertible. So if we have time to do some more special editions, I would be thrilled.
